48.7.1.1 TSI electrode oscillator
The TSI electrode oscillator circuit is illustrated in the following figure. A configurable
constant current source is used to charge and discharge the external electrode
capacitance. A buffer hysteresis defines the oscillator delta voltage. The delta voltage
defines the margin of high and low voltage which are the reference input of the
comparator in different time.
The current source applied to the pad capacitance is 5-bit binary controlled by the
SCANC[EXTCHRG]. The hysteresis delta voltage is also configurable and is 3-bit binary
controlled by the SCANC[DELVOL]. The figure below shows the voltage amplitude
waveform of the electrode capacitance charging and discharging with a programmable
current.
